Pelvic Physical Therapist - Full Time

Jackson Therapy Partners Medford, Oregon, US

About the Role

We’re looking for a Pelvic Physical Therapist to take on a full-time role with one of our area clients. You’ll help patients move better, feel better, and stay active—whether they’re recovering from an injury or managing long-term conditions. Minimum Requirements:

  • Doctoral, Master’s, or Bachelor’s degree in Physical Therapy from an accredited program approved by the APTA.
  • Active Oregon PT license required to start the position.
  • Experience or interest in pelvic health physical therapy. This opening is specifically for a Pelvic PT.
  • Ability to deliver 45-minute one-on-one patient sessions and manage back-to-back appointments with charting time built into the schedule.
  • Strong teamwork, punctuality, professional presentation, and reliable attendance.
  • BLS certification from AHA or ARC may be required.


Benefits:

  • Medical, dental, and vision for 40-hour employees. Employer covers dental and vision and contributes toward medical premiums. Four medical plan options available.
  • 401(k) with up to 3.5% employer match.
  • Generous PTO accrual
  • Quarterly volume-based bonus program beginning at 80% capacity.
  • Continuing education reimbursement up to $1,500 annually and increased pay for additional certifications.
  • New hire mentoring program and flexible hours.
  • Sign-on bonus and potential relocation assistance may be available on a case-by-case basis.


Practice & Team:

  • Locally owned, independent outpatient practice with multiple locations within a 20-minute radius.
  • Team-oriented, collaborative environment with regular company events and business casual dress code.
  • Hiring two PTs: Pelvic PT (this role) and/or Orthopedic PT. Flexibility to work at other nearby locations if desired.


Location Highlights

Medford, OR offers access to outdoor recreation, cultural attractions, and a manageable cost of living. Explore the nearby Rogue River for fishing and rafting, visit the Rogue Valley vineyards and tasting rooms, and enjoy access to hiking and skiing in the Cascade and Siskiyou ranges. Downtown Medford includes dining, galleries, and community events. The area supports a balanced lifestyle with local parks and family-friendly activities.
